Alert: rate-limit rejection ratio on the Coalmere internal API gateway exceeded 15% over five minutes. Likely causes: a misconfigured client retry loop, a stale quota config push, or burst traffic from the Driftbank batch jobs. Check the gateway quota dashboard, identify the top offending client, and throttle at the edge if needed. Do not raise global limits without approval. If the offender is unidentifiable, contact the gateway owners.

escalation mailbox, kadup-fajof: ulador@qirvanlabs.corp

RUNBOOK — Courier Substitution After Missed Pick-up

If the booked courier misses the pick-up window, the warehouse shift lead cancels the original booking in the dispatch log and requests a substitute from the approved reserve list only. Verify the replacement driver's run sheet matches the consignment number before releasing anything from the cage. Re-seal the consignment with a fresh tamper tag and record both old and new tag numbers. Note the substitution reason in the shift report. The confidential hand-over step is set out below.

handover note for yagef-bagep: the drudor pelius courier leaves the kasdor zorvan norir ledger at gate 8016 under passcode 755406

Handover note — Crumbwheel order cutoffs.

Welcome aboard. The bakery cutoff rule in Crumbwheel closes same-day orders at 14:00 local to each storefront, not UTC — this has bitten us twice. Holiday overrides live in the calendar service and take precedence silently, so always check there first when a cutoff looks wrong. To unlock the calendar service's admin console after a restart, enter the recovery passphrase below.

vault phrase of bagap-bahaf = silion-pelox-sorox-casdor-quenwyn-fraax-eliox-praael-kelion-quenvan-kasox-rusael-norius-belvan

Subject: Hollowgate 3.2.1 — websocket reconnect fix. Plugin authors: we've patched the bug where the Hollowgate client dropped subscriptions after a reconnect triggered by proxy idle timeouts. Sessions now resume with the prior subscription set, so plugins no longer need the manual re-subscribe workaround; you can remove it once you target 3.2.1. Fenna verified against the three reference plugins. The fixed build is identified by the token below.

pipeline stamp: htk31_f769b577b3028a4e9958e5bb8d1259a